Answer to Question 1

Researchers and practitioners still refer to Birren and Renner's (1980) classic argument that mentally healthy people have the following characteristics: a positive attitude toward the self, an accurate perception of reality, a mastery of their environment, autonomy, personality balance, and growth and self-actualization. One argument is that, to the extent that these factors are missing or absent, mental disorder or psychopathology becomes more likely.

Did you know?

In 1885, the Lloyd Manufacturing Company of Albany, New York, promoted and sold "Cocaine Toothache Drops" at 15 cents per bottle! In 1914, the Harrison Narcotic Act brought the sale and distribution of this drug under federal control.
